Ilkley Armed Forces and Veterans Breakfast Club marked the close of another successful year with a Christmas Lunch held at The Lister Arms in Ilkley.
The event was well attended despite the busy festive period, reflecting the continued strength and popularity of the club within the local defence community. Members gathered to recognise the importance of connection, mutual support, and camaraderie that the club provides throughout the year.
The club also expressed its thanks to the staff at The Lister Arms for their support and hospitality in hosting the event, which helped ensure the day ran smoothly.
Ilkley Armed Forces and Veterans Breakfast Club is open to serving personnel, veterans, and members of the wider defence community, offering a welcoming, informal environment to reconnect and support one another.
The club meets on the last Saturday of every month from 10:00am to 12:00pm at The Lister Arms.
The club recently invited Kirklees Local TV to film at one of the meetings.
A spokesperson said:
"New members are always welcome. As the club’s ethos encourages: “Return to the tribe.”
"The club looks forward to continuing its work supporting veterans and the armed forces community into the new year."
